Misappropriation of over Rs 50 lakh in All Saints’ school

SHILLONG: The secretary of the Diocese Church of North East India, Donald Ingty has accused the office staff of All Saints’ school in the city of misappropriating students’ fees to the tune of Rs 53.93 lakh.
In his complaint, Ingty stated that the management committee of the school detected discrepancies in the number of students in the audited statement which is substantially lower to that in the attendance register.
“On scrutinising the collection of fees from the students, it was found that Rs. 53, 93,621 collected as fees was not deposited in the bank,” Ingty said and added that five persons– F.G. Daimari, the accountant, Supriyo Biswa, the assistant accountant, Rishot Shanpru, Banteibah Niangti and Dhurbajeet Dey, employed by the school may have misappropriated the amount.
